CC   -!- FUNCTION: Part of the tripartite ATP-independent periplasmic (TRAP)
CC       transport system. {ECO:0000256|RuleBase:RU369079}.
CC   -!- SUBUNIT: The complex comprises the extracytoplasmic solute receptor
CC       protein and the two transmembrane proteins.
CC       {ECO:0000256|RuleBase:RU369079}.
CC   -!- SUBCELLULAR LOCATION: Cell inner membrane
CC       {ECO:0000256|ARBA:ARBA00004429, ECO:0000256|RuleBase:RU369079}; Multi-
CC       pass membrane protein {ECO:0000256|ARBA:ARBA00004429,
CC       ECO:0000256|RuleBase:RU369079}. Membrane
CC       {ECO:0000256|ARBA:ARBA00004141}; Multi-pass membrane protein
CC       {ECO:0000256|ARBA:ARBA00004141}.
CC   -!- SIMILARITY: Belongs to the TRAP transporter large permease family.
CC       {ECO:0000256|RuleBase:RU369079}.
